Successful Consulting Skills
This seminar is based on the steps of Flawless Consulting, a book
authored by Peter Block. Participants will engage in a consulting
simulation, as both the consultant and the client, which will enable
them to learn and practice a consulting sequence and experientially
increase consultative knowledge and skills.
This workshop focuses initially on various theories of what a
consultant is and what a consultant does. A review of more than eight
recognizable roles that a consultant can take is also included early
in the workshop. Seminar discussion is then devoted to identifying
each of the twelve (12) Consulting Steps, demonstrating critical
steps, and providing an opportunity to practice.
Learning objectives:
-
Understand and apply specific steps of the Consulting Sequence
-
Clarify and confirm expectations of both the client and the consultant
-
Direct the process of needs assessment
-
Practice for enhancement, the skills of contracting, interviewing,
listening, idea recording and feedback, and guiding the process of
action planning

The Extended DISC Personal Analysis is a self-assessment tool for
measuring a person's natural behavioral style. It produces the
following information:
-
Attributes describing the person
-
Communication Style
-
Ideal Supervisor
-
Decision Making Style
-
Specific Motivators and Fears
-
Strengths and Weaknesses
-
Sales Style
-
Management and Supervisory Style
-
Customer Service Style
-
Administrative Style
-
Entrepreneurial Style
-
Team Style

Helping Individuals Through
Organizational Change
This workshop is designed for individuals who are being affected by
change within their organizations yet may have had little influence in
the change initiative. It is structured to help those individuals deal
with the organizational change in a more positive way and decrease the
accompanying distress and disruption in their lives. This program is
also ideally suited for internal and external trainers that need the
necessary skills and tools to conduct this workshop. Complete Leader's
Guides, Participant Workbooks and Video are available for purchase.
Call for details.
Participants will learn about:
-
Information Concerns - needing more information about the change
-
Personal Concerns - perceiving the change as a personal threat
-
Operational Concerns - coordination, logistics, and time for
implementing and supporting the change
-
Impact Concerns - affect of change on the organization as a whole
-
Collaboration Concerns - sharing with others how to implement the
change
-
Transforming Concerns - thinking about making major adjustments to the
change or trying something totally different.
